8200669065,STABILIZER,LINK,FRONT R/L
Product Description
OEM NO.
80166159
8200669065
Linked Vehicles
CAR NAME | MODEL | YEARS | POSITION |
RENAULT RENAULT RENAULT RENAULT | KANGOO MEGANE II GRAND SCENICSCENIC II | 08~ 02~ 04~ 03~ | FRONT R/L |
OEM NO.
80166159
8200669065
Linked Vehicles
CAR NAME | MODEL | YEARS | POSITION |
RENAULT RENAULT RENAULT RENAULT | KANGOO MEGANE II GRAND SCENICSCENIC II | 08~ 02~ 04~ 03~ | FRONT R/L |